Technical Specifications
Fuel Petrol Petrol
Engine Displacement 803.00 cc 765.00 cc
Engine L-Twin, Desmodromic distribution, 2 valves per cylinder, air cooled Liquid-cooled, 12 valve, DOHC, in-line 3-cylinder
Engine Starting -- Electric Push Start
Engine Lubrication -- Wet Sump
Clutch APTC wet multiplate with mechanical control Wet, multi-plate assist clutch
Fuel System Electronic fuel injection, 50 mm throttle body Multipoint sequential electronic fuel injection with SAI. Electronic throttle control
Cooling System -- Liquid Cooled
Maximum Power 55 kW @ 8250 rpm 111.5 bhp @ 11250rpm
Maximum Torque 68 Nm @ 5750 rpm 73Nm @ 9100rpm
Transmission 6 speed 6-Speed Manual
Gear Shift Pattern -- 1-N-2-3-4-5-6
Frame Tubular steel Trellis frame Front - Aluminium beam twin spar. Rear - 2 piece high pressure die cast
Headlamp -- LED
Taillamp -- LED Tail Lamp
Tyres
Front Pirelli MT 60 RS 110/80 ZR18 120/70ZR17
Rear Pirelli MT 60 RS 180/55 ZR17 180/55ZR17
Wheel / RIM -- Cast aluminium alloy multi-spoke
Brakes
Front 330 mm disc, radial 4-piston calliper with ABS as standard equipment 310mm twin floating discs, Nissin 2-piston sliding calipers
Rear 245 mm disc, 1-piston floating calliper with ABS as standard equipment 220mm Single fixed disc, Brembo single piston sliding caliper
Suspension
Front Upside down Kayaba 41 mm fork Showa 41mm upside down separate function forks (SFF), 110mm front wheel travel
Rear Kayaba rear shock, pre-load adjustable Showa piggyback reservoir monoshock, 124mm rear wheel travel. Adjustable preload
Colors Available
Colors -- Phantom Black and Diablo Red


Physical Specs
Length 2165 mm --
Width 845 mm 735 mm
Height 1150 mm 1060 mm
Weight 176.5 kg 166 kg
Wheelbase 1445 mm 1410 mm
Fuel Tank Capacity 13.5 litres 17.4 litres
